Today was a very unique and interesting day. The following is a description of the collage of photos above, correlating with the numbers.

Austin, TX. 12:00pm. Mojo’s Café. That was where about fifty deviants were supposed to meet on Saturday, February 21, 2004.

My day started with *dusty129, a friend of around 10 years, coming to my house. Another friend of mine, *jasato (James) had spent the night with me to make it quicker and more efficient for Dusty to come get us. So we departed around 9:00 in the morning in an Oldsmobile. We got on the highway and headed towards Austin. On the way, James wanted to smoke a cigarette, so he lit one up and rolled down Dusty’s window so as to not bother us non-smokers as much. One thing he did not know was that Dusty’s window does not roll up as easily as it rolls down. Needless to say, we were all freezing balls the way there, and the way back. Not to mention the already-bad-speakers were faint to be heard over the noise the wind made. It was looking lovely already. Around this time #1 was taken. 10:36.

So we arrive in Austin at about 11:00 AM, a whole hour earlier than expected. No matter, we would find Mojo’s and then go do something in the meantime. Dusty was driving and thought he missed his exit, so he took the next one available. Turns out it was the exact street Mojo’s was on, only a few blocks down. Pretty damn good, eh? So as we went down, we had no idea what it looked like, we saw a Blockbuster’s. Me and Dusty work for Blockbuster, so we wanted to go in and see how it differed from our store, and to alleviate our bladders. As Dusty gets out of the car, he tells me to look across the street. Lo-and-behold, there’s fuckin’ Mojo’s. Damn good, again! We made good time without even trying! Seeing as it was across the street, we decided to leave the car parked in the Blockbuster parking lot. See photo #2 and #3.

After doing our business, we killed some time by talking to the Blockbuster manager on duty, and then headed over to Mojo’s. We sat down, grabbed the local free paper, and waited. At about 12:00 exactly, *crazyleafhead (Shay) showed up. Slowly, more and more showed up. Next was ~inferis (David). In no particular order, *lady-blue, * capricious and others showed up. Handshakes were exchanged, the normal. While we were sitting there, waiting for $spot (Spot) and crew, Dusty spotted a chicken in the road. After realizing the irony of this, via the classic joke, we all broke out our cameras. The chicken was trying to cross the road. We all scrambled shots. #4. 12:41.(click here for *darkrune’s awesome shot) After getting some of his own photos, Dusty took it upon himself to try and prevent some chicken roadkill. His solution was to run out in front of traffic, effectively stopping it, while he ran/scared the chicken away, eventually back to the side it had started on. I think this particular chicken crossed the road just to see what it was like on the other side, because he came back. Guess it wasn’t impressive?

Anywho, it’s about an hour after the meeting time, but it’s okay, we’re just sitting here anyway, not planning on going anywhere. Soon $spot, %skittleboi and %rzero show up. By now we had around 25 deviants. Some had to leave quickly, like *heartstaken (photo #5 on the left. Right is Shay) So after that $ spot, whose real legal name is Spot, told us about many new ideas DeviantArt is pushing around right now, and many old ones that have yet to be implemented. He filled us in on who does what, and how much they do. He gave many props to fellow admins for their amazing hard work put into the site. Some history, who got hired, when, by whom. All interesting things I have not seen anywhere written. In #6, Spot is the man on the far right with his arm raised.

After more very informative talks from Spot, Shay decided to do the giveaway now. A shirt, a `jasinski calendar, prints accounts and varying lengths of subscriptions. Coincidentally, my name was chosen first. I got the shirt. This was nice, but it was two sizes too small (L). I told her to give it to someone else. What I forgot was, my name remained out of the hat. (photo #7 ). No matter, later events will reciprocate for me not winning anything. Read on.

David (photo #8) won the `jasinski calendar! :clap: After that, more talking went on. Actually, more like me asking $ spot a hundred questions, and him answering me very informatively and patiently (photo #9). Photo #10 shows * lady-blue wearing something to help us all remember her name. She graciously gave up her seat and settles for the table.

Photo #11 is Shay’s camera. Such quality!
Photo #12 is someone pointing the finger of blame at someone else.

So much much talking went on… #13 is David photographing me. #14 is % skittleboi (Josh) and %rzero (William) taking photos. Willy seen here touching nipples.

After a bit Spot needed to download his camera, for it was already full. He pulls out a laptop, downloads them. Logs on to deviantART to assign the subscription winners immediately. (#15 ). Photo #16 is a closeup of some administrative-tool screen. Nothing ‘top secret’, but pixilated purposely to prevent Spot from worrying and to keep everyone wondering. :P

Around the time we all stood around Spot’s laptop, a man (#17) asked us some questions, who we were, what we were doing. Friendly like. Then he gets very rude towards us saying we hadn’t bought anything, when, in fact, many of us had, and how we were taking up 2/3’s of the outside seats, which was true. He was just an asshole, so I took his photo while he was looking just to prove to him how much I gave a shit (zero percent).

GROUP PHOTO TIME!. This man, a friend of a deviant, was kind enough to take all of our photos with about seven cameras total. (photo #18).

The hugeass photo in the middle is the group photo, I do not know everyone’s name by face, so I won’t even try. Someone did though, click here for * darkrune’s group photo (same spots, different people’s eyes’ closed :P) with names added.

Photo #19 was taken at 15:15. We had passed some time, just talking. About half of the group decided to leave, and the remainder sat and talked until we decided to eat something. Taco Bell or Burger King was the choice. Spot, using administrative powers, threatened to ban us all if we did not vote for Taco Bell, so we did. :lmao: Photo #20 you can see Spot and his ‘ready to eat!’ face. #21 is another shot of the ordering process. #22 is eating! #23 is Spot holding his nose, probably due to some kind of gas excreted.
Spot received a call from `missmisery, and handed the phone to David (photo #24 ).

Wile we were finishing up, the man in photo #25 showed up and asked for money. Nobody in our group gave him any, but the one in this photo gave him some.

There’s a slight pause now, no photographs to help along the story, because this part of the story is the negative part. No time to take photos. As we walked out of Taco Bell, we looked for Dusty’s Oldsmobile. IT WAS GONE. We had left it parked at the Blockbuster, and now it was no longer there. DUDE, WHERE’s DUSTY’S CAR?!. He went inside, found out that it had been towed. So he got the towing number, it would cost him $130 to get it back. Spot and co. had to get back and deliver people to Houston and then go to Dallas, so they had to go. Shay and David hung around, which was extremely courteous of them. We called Dusty’s dad, who would meet us at the towers’ with cash. Thank god I didn’t have to pitch in, I have shit I needed to buy :P. Shay and Michael gave us money, because we didn’t know if we would have enough at first, but after Dusty’s dad spotted us, we returned the cash. Shay then drove us to the towing place, and David went to get his car, parked far away, and return. A few minutes later, after finding the place with some difficulty, David called Shay’s phone and says he’s locked is key’s in his car!. This day gets progressively better. So while we were at the towers, we told them of his situation, and they were going to get his keys out for $25. We left, wishing them the both the best of luck, and thanking them for their extreme kindness to practical ‘strangers’. How :devart: brings us together. Ahh, the love :heart:

After solving this major problem, we piled into the car and started to head off. It was about 18:30 when we left. The sky looked cool, it wasn’t any beautiful colors, but I turned my camera on and took some photos.

As the minutes went by, the sky got exceedingly more pink, because of the sunset and the suns’ rays hitting the atmosphere at that angle. The result are photos #26. Quite a beautiful ending to a hectic day.

On the drive home, on the highway, we saw the license plate, shown in photo #27, ‘NO LIE’. Very odd. Some kind of sign? You tell me.

We’re about 10 miles from home when Dusty decides to get gas, which, of course, requires the engine off. Dusty’s engine goes off more easily than it goes on, same as his window. So, we’re S.O.L. But no, Dusty breaks out his jack, some wrenches and gets down on the dirt in his ‘good pants’. Takes off the starter of the car, and short-circuits the bitch. Key turned, engine rolls. We’re in business again, after about thirty minutes.

No other problems befell us between that gas station and home. We talked about the days events, and how long these journal entries would be. I decided, though, just to make mine a story/photo collage, the one seen here.

I hope you have enjoyed my description of the events in the life of one deviant, on Saturday, February 21, 2004. I really enjoyed this meet. Everyone was excellent. Great conversations. Even a few unavoidable ones about religion and politics. :P I am now committed to future meets. Any time, anywhere in Texas, and I’m there. Annual sounds fun, no?

Regardless, that is the kind of badass day you have when you belong to the largest, fastest growing, and ,most importantly, best art community on the world of the internet.
